Output 83717a6904ee37c7d77b69c18f6f74a2c3008bcbf5c7df72a0365abfc765b314:0

value
756883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9dd3869d6f7482c78013cab536b656ebceb60b38 OP_EQUAL
address
3G5XQjXt2zykhcGjMVkeSsN2Me3A6Bkj5p
transaction
83717a6904ee37c7d77b69c18f6f74a2c3008bcbf5c7df72a0365abfc765b314
confirmations
61206
spent
true